Ickie, DCS stands for Digital Combat Simulator and is a Russian combat sim product. Started with the A-10C, Warthog and is now expanded to include the P-51D and several other products. Don't forget you can download DCS World for free, which includes the SU-25, but that's one of their older models and no way near up to the same standard as the A-10, Mustang, FC3 aircraft and Huey (that's great, I bought it yesterday, but it's a bit of a learning experience). The models will take you a while to learn because all the systems are modelled, but note that the aircraft in Flaming Cliffs 3 are not as accurate as the individual modules.

Actually, I bought the Warthog A-10 through Steam when it was on sale, which it is occasionally. I got the rest through DCS directly though. Steam only has the early Black Shark, not Black Shark II.

I tried out the free DCS world with the Russian jet and wasn't impressed. Then I got the Warthog on a Steam sale and was blown away. The world graphics are nothing like the best FSX addons (Orbx), but they aren't terrible. The aircraft graphics are phenomenal. The virtual cockpits are lifelike. The lighting dynamics are incredible. I don't think DX10 in FSX is as good. It's hyper-realistic. The flight models are very, very good. I got the Huey and the KA-50. Don't have the P-51 yet, nor am I sure I will get it, since I'm quite happy with the A2A birds, but the possibility of dogfighting in her is tempting. There's no helicopter you can get for FSX that is as good as the DCS Huey (I have the Dodo and the Aerosoft Huey...which no longer works with my controls correctly anyway).

If you are into complex systems, almost completely modeled with full fidelity, excellent flight dynamics and unparalleled virtual cockpits, then you should check DCS out. They are still developing, and a new terrain engine is in process.
